What to Consider When Choosing the Best Mop for Tile Floors

As shared, a mop is one of the essential tools for cleaning and cleaning the house. However, many housewives find it quite challenging to choose the right product for their family's needs. They can be easier to clean with additional features such as a handle, a spray mechanism, or a mop. 

Type

Here are the popular mops today that you can refer to:

  • String mops: This is a traditional mop, suitable for cleaning homes and offices with a mop made from yarns or loops, cotton yarn. This type of mop has the advantage of good absorbent ability, effective in the process of cleaning large surfaces. In addition, they also quickly go into tight corners and tight spaces. However, they also have the disadvantage that it is difficult to dry completely. If left in a humid, wet condition for a long time, the mop will quickly create a bad smell. 

  • Strip mop: This type of mop is quite similar to a string mop, but its mop head is made of cloth strips, not cotton cords. Fabric strips are often made from synthetic materials, so they tend to absorb less water and dry faster. Therefore, strip mops are less likely to get wet and smelly than string mops.

  • Flat mops: An item with a flat head and a mop. The wipes are disposable and can be used by hand or machine. This is also considered a gentle, easy choice for everyday use. 

  • Spray mops: This item helps users quickly move and clean every house corner. With this spray mop, you'll need an extra bottle of cleaning solution threaded to the mop's handle. Every time you use it, you just need to pull the trigger. The answer will spray on the floor to clean easily.

  • Steam mops: An item with a water tank that can be refilled at any time. When the mop is turned on, the water will heat up and turn into steam, spreading through the mop head and down the floor. The hot steam will disinfect and clean stubborn stains. This steam mop is an excellent choice for sealed ceramic and porcelain tiles. In addition, they are also one of the most common types of bricks used in residential homes.

Mophead

The material of the mop will affect the level of absorption and abrasion of the mop. Here are the common materials of mops that you can refer to use:

  • Cotton: This material is reasonably priced, affordable, and has good absorbency. The reason is that they are easily absorbed. Suction and clean up the turbulent liquid. However, this material also has the disadvantage of slow drying and is susceptible to mold or damp odors. 

  • Synthetic: This material is considered more durable than cotton, and synthetic fibers usually dry quickly. As a result, they are less susceptible to moisture and mold.

  • Microfiber: This material is durable and easy to clean. Microfiber mops often have a soft absorbent ability and do not cause abrasion or damage to your floors and tiles. 

  • Sponge: Usually made of sponge material with an ideal, clean texture. Some sponge mop heads can push dirty water into the tile grout, making them quickly tarnish after a period of use. However, this sponge is still a great choice because they have a good cleaning ability.

Wringing Mechanism

To avoid damaging the floor, wiping with a damp but not too wet mop head is best. In addition, they need a different wringing mechanism for the mop to work. The mop squeegee is usually placed on the handle of the mop or in the mop bucket.

Most of the mop squeegee is usually designed as a lever or a screw mechanism on the mop's handle. They will then activate the extractor to pressurize the mop to squeeze out excess water. 

With this lever design squeegee, we can easily see it on the mops. The mechanism folds or rolls the sponge when the lever is pulled to force the water out. 

In addition, some wire or strip mops widely available in the market will have a self-squeeze design. This means they have a twist mechanism to wind the mop fibers and remove water easily.

The bucket extractor will be built-in in into the bucket of the mop. Some squeegees are as simple as squeezing water from a mop using manual pressure. 

The bucket part comes with a mop and allows for hands-free wringing instead of having to touch a wet, dirty mop. The rotary mop model is convenient and dries faster than other bucket squeegees. 

Handle

The handle of the mop is very much related to the factor of the level of comfort when using the mop. The mop handle is usually made of plastic, wood, or metal.

Wooden or metal handle material will be less likely to bend or break. Plastic is often used for additional features and accessories such as buttons, levers, nozzles, and holds.

Regardless of the mop handle material, you should choose one with ergonomics or a non-slip handle for added comfort. Because the non-slip grip will help users easily control the mop even when their hands are wet. 

In addition, the comfortable, ergonomic handle also makes it easy to use the mop for a long time without fatigue or tightness. 

Adjustability

The handle is height-adjustable, stretching or contracting to suit users of all heights. This factor is also helpful and essential when learning to buy the best floor mop. With the adjustable handle, users will not have to stoop or hold the handle for too long.

Those in charge of sweeping and mopping should consider using a mop with an adjustable handle. The short handle will allow you to apply more pressure while scrubbing and washing stubborn stains. Therefore, a high, long handle will be much more suitable if cleaning is gentle.
